Cytokinetics, located in Greater London, seeks a Key Account and Access Manager to drive growth and access of cardiovascular biopharmaceuticals across the UK. This role demands 5+ years of experience in the biotech/pharma industry, focusing on secondary care sales or field-based market access.
Responsibilities include managing relationships with Integrated Care Boards and executing local access strategies to enhance patient pathways. The ideal candidate will possess strong analytical skills and familiarity with NHS dynamics.
